Ticket: Config drift on TilePloughshare prefetcher nodes. During the quarterly audit we found the staging prefetchers running cache limits and zoom ranges that diverge from the approved baseline in the Harbinger repo. No exploit suspected, but please verify nothing weakens our egress posture. The currently deployed values on staging are as follows.

deployment values, yafop-tahof:
HOLIX_HOST=holix.zemvarsys.internal
HOLIX_PORT=3306

## Onboarding: DupeSquash

DupeSquash collapses duplicate on-call alerts before they hit PagerLine. Support handles tier-1 triage when dedup rules misfire. Know these basics: alerts are fingerprinted by service, severity, and message hash. Matching alerts within a 10-minute window merge into one incident. To inspect a merged incident, use the `dupesquash inspect` command on the ops jumpbox. Escalate rule changes to the Reliability pod in Marwick Bay. Queries against the DupeSquash admin API require authentication. Use the key below.

API key for yahig-tadup: kto7_ubizbYm

Notes for the weekly eng sync: role-based access in the Thimbleweed wiki now runs through service accounts. The svc-thimble-rbac account syncs group mappings nightly and holds admin scope only during the sync window. Manual edits to role tables are disabled. Automation that queries the role API should authenticate with the key below.

gateway credential: kto3_qfe